A delicate display serif with hairline strokes and pronounced thick–thin transitions that create a crisp, shimmering rhythm. Serifs are sharp and often wedge-like, with occasional flared terminals and small ball details in the lowercase. Curves are taut and clean, counters are open, and the overall construction feels sculpted rather than calligraphic, with a slightly decorative finish that shows strongly in letters like a, g, y, and the numerals.
Best suited to headlines, mastheads, pull quotes, and brand marks where its high-contrast detailing can be appreciated. It can work well in premium packaging and fashion or beauty identities, particularly when set with generous spacing and at sizes that protect the hairline strokes.
The tone is elegant and dramatic, combining couture-level refinement with a playful, ornamental edge. Its thin lines and sharp finishing give it a luxurious, high-end voice, while the occasional curls and terminals add a subtly eccentric, boutique feel.
The design appears intended as a statement display serif: a refined, modern-feeling letterform base enhanced with decorative terminals and sharp serifs to create a memorable, boutique personality.
The design favors display impact over neutrality: thin horizontals and fine joins make texture appear airy, while heavier verticals create strong vertical emphasis. In the sample text, the high contrast produces a distinctive sparkle and a stylized word shape, especially at larger sizes.
